LA: Where Brownstones Go to Die (or Never Existed)

Why the brownstone drought in the City of Angels? Well, for starters, earthquakes. Those little tremors don’t exactly do wonders for brick and mortar. Plus, let's be honest, the whole brownstone aesthetic doesn't exactly scream "California casual." It’s more like "New York hustle."

Brownstone-Inspired Living in LA

While genuine brownstones are as rare as a vegan at a barbecue, there are a few options to scratch that brownstone itch:

  • Brownstone-Inspired Apartments: Some buildings in LA have managed to capture the essence of a brownstone with modern amenities. Think exposed brick walls, high ceilings, and maybe even a hint of that New York charm.
  • Loft Living: Lofts can often offer that spacious, open feel reminiscent of a converted brownstone. Plus, you get that trendy industrial edge.
  • Architectural Digest Dreams: If you've got the cash, you could always commission a custom-built brownstone replica. But let's be real, this is probably more of a fantasy than a reality for most of us.

So, while you might not find the perfect brownstone in LA, you can definitely create a space that captures its spirit. Just remember, you'll probably still need to drive to get your bagels and a good slice of pizza.
